> On Jan 28,  8:04pm, Thomas Richter wrote:
> 
> Possible reasons for the history not to be read are:
> 
> - the NO_RCS option is set (the doc says this prevents history from
>   being written, but it also suppresses reading it)

This option is not set.
 
> - the INTERACT option is not set

This option is set.
 
> - lockhistfile() fails because
>   + a temporary lock file can't be created in the same directory
>     as the HISTFILE

How can I test this?

>   + a link to that temp file can't be created

ln -s $HISTFILE newname is ok

>   + something else [possibly several somethings] has the file locked
>     for more than about 10 seconds (but this shouldn't apply at shell
>     startup, only for incremental history)

no process has this file open
 
> - the file can't be opened for reading

cat $HISTFILE is ok 

> - some part of the file is corrupt

no contains only one line with one word
 
> - HISTSIZE is zero (in which case, I believe, the file is read but all
>   the contents are discarded)

HISTSIZE = 99999
 
> My (new, ahem) guess is that the problem is with the lock file.
